Commit Graph

1919 Commits (9fdfd82bc0e03d491412314125718fd1be1b7fee)
 

Author SHA1 Message Date
Tiger Oakes 84349bda63 [fenix] Extract quick action sheet observer code (https://github.com/mozilla-mobile/fenix/pull/4368) 5 years ago
Emily Kager 80b2c4ee51 [fenix] For https://github.com/mozilla-mobile/fenix/issues/4799 https://github.com/mozilla-mobile/fenix/issues/4790 - Don't use passed in sessions in BrowserToolbarController (https://github.com/mozilla-mobile/fenix/pull/4800) 5 years ago
Colin Lee 47bbb9081d [fenix] For https://github.com/mozilla-mobile/fenix/issues/4686: Fix potential security issue (https://github.com/mozilla-mobile/fenix/pull/4764) 5 years ago
Yeon Taek Jeong d72c8cf1b6 [fenix] No issue: fixes click failures on search widget icon 5 years ago
Emily Kager 043f8829c9 [fenix] For https://github.com/mozilla-mobile/fenix/issues/4688 - Try to use context instead of targetContext (https://github.com/mozilla-mobile/fenix/pull/4765) 5 years ago
Sawyer Blatz 6dd829fdb4 [fenix] No issue: Add threshold to codecov (https://github.com/mozilla-mobile/fenix/pull/4751) 5 years ago
Yeon Taek Jeong b1fdb6a353 [fenix] For https://github.com/mozilla-mobile/fenix/issues/4736: Display search shortcuts only from home or search widget 5 years ago
Emily Kager 52ff9a61f0 [fenix] For https://github.com/mozilla-mobile/fenix/issues/4688 - Try slightly different Context class for MockWebServer (https://github.com/mozilla-mobile/fenix/pull/4747) 5 years ago
Emily Kager b037ddee5a [fenix] Closes https://github.com/mozilla-mobile/fenix/issues/4680 - Align collection creation text center vertical 5 years ago
Yeon Taek Jeong 6c41d30fd8 [fenix] For https://github.com/mozilla-mobile/fenix/issues/4384: Hide mic icon if speech-to-text is unavailable (https://github.com/mozilla-mobile/fenix/pull/4701) 5 years ago
Yeon Taek Jeong 8efb7f9cdb [fenix] For https://github.com/mozilla-mobile/fenix/issues/4516: Use full width for large search widgets (https://github.com/mozilla-mobile/fenix/pull/4659) 5 years ago
Emily Kager e4f3b39e0b [fenix] Closes https://github.com/mozilla-mobile/fenix/issues/3860 - Update description text for collections 5 years ago
Sawyer Blatz 6cfbb2c02b [fenix] For https://github.com/mozilla-mobile/fenix/issues/4421: Adds Leanplum events and attributes (https://github.com/mozilla-mobile/fenix/pull/4626)
* For https://github.com/mozilla-mobile/fenix/issues/4421: Adds Leanplum events and attributes

* For https://github.com/mozilla-mobile/fenix/issues/4421: Adds Leanplum deep links
5 years ago
Yeon Taek Jeong 309b86544c [fenix] For https://github.com/mozilla-mobile/fenix/issues/4421: Add search widget attribute to Leanplum (https://github.com/mozilla-mobile/fenix/pull/4694) 5 years ago
Yeon Taek Jeong 468c400ff5 [fenix] For https://github.com/mozilla-mobile/fenix/issues/4457: Adds telemetry for search widget actions (https://github.com/mozilla-mobile/fenix/pull/4714) 5 years ago
Yeon Taek Jeong 2c70a18a62 [fenix] For https://github.com/mozilla-mobile/fenix/issues/4732: Fix search engine display issue (https://github.com/mozilla-mobile/fenix/pull/4735) 5 years ago
Mihai Adrian 4835dbb1a8 [fenix] For https://github.com/mozilla-mobile/fenix/issues/4434 - made close button for collections more accessible. (https://github.com/mozilla-mobile/fenix/pull/4443)
* fixes https://github.com/mozilla-mobile/fenix/issues/4434 - made close button for collections more accessible.

set recommended minimum size for accessibility 48x48, while keeping image size the same
removed margin from button as it was not needed anymore
aligned close button in center of tab to be visual consistent with alignment of favicon and more visual accessible
implemented same visual solution as for https://github.com/mozilla-mobile/fenix/issues/4193 - close button for tabs

* fixes https://github.com/mozilla-mobile/fenix/issues/4434 - made buttons for collection home list row more accessible and aligned 3 dot menu with individual tabs close button

set buttons sizes to recommended minimum size for accessibility 48x48, while keeping image size the same
removed margins from buttons as they were not needed anymore
aligned center of menu buttons with center of collection icon
constrained description top to bottom of title, instead of share button to reduce empty space. (overlap with share button is already prevented by end constraint of description)
5 years ago
Michael Cooper 9646181343 [fenix] Add no-op experiment to test service-experiments integration (https://github.com/mozilla-mobile/fenix/pull/4551)
* Add no-op experiment to test service-experiments integration

* Shorten metric name to meet schema

* Add active_experiment metric to docs

* Add approved data review
5 years ago
Jeff Boek 2e49f5b8b0 [fenix] Release documentation (https://github.com/mozilla-mobile/fenix/pull/4617)
* For https://github.com/mozilla-mobile/fenix/issues/4258 - Create release checklist

* For https://github.com/mozilla-mobile/fenix/issues/4258 - Adds table for sprint / release schedule

* For https://github.com/mozilla-mobile/fenix/issues/4258 - Fixes nits
5 years ago
Tiger Oakes 07eda357ba [fenix] Use global navigation action for browser fragment (https://github.com/mozilla-mobile/fenix/pull/4691) 5 years ago
isabelrios 61e400c2d8 [fenix] Fix UI Screenshot TabMenuTest (https://github.com/mozilla-mobile/fenix/pull/4730) 5 years ago
Colin Lee 4987c40d67 [fenix] For https://github.com/mozilla-mobile/fenix/issues/1667: Screen reader can't reach other UI items when QAB expanded (https://github.com/mozilla-mobile/fenix/pull/4695) 5 years ago
Emily Kager bf76cbe7e6 [fenix] No issue - Autoformatting (https://github.com/mozilla-mobile/fenix/pull/4715) 5 years ago
Sebastian Kaspari c30700580c [fenix] Closes https://github.com/mozilla-mobile/fenix/issues/4719: Get rid of fragment-testing dependency and create fragments in StoreProviderTest manually. (https://github.com/mozilla-mobile/fenix/pull/4722) 5 years ago
Colin Lee 2de56210e2 [fenix] For https://github.com/mozilla-mobile/fenix/issues/4709: Fix Bugzilla issue 1573549 (https://github.com/mozilla-mobile/fenix/pull/4710) 5 years ago
Sourabh 9c7caab6e3 [fenix] fix https://github.com/mozilla-mobile/fenix/issues/4633: show toast only on first login (https://github.com/mozilla-mobile/fenix/pull/4676)
This is a very low-risk PR, which should not require a rebase to deal with the scope issue today in TaskCluster.
5 years ago
(´⌣`ʃƪ) f292286006 [fenix] Fix https://github.com/mozilla-mobile/fenix/issues/4436: hide onboarding before navigating to settings (https://github.com/mozilla-mobile/fenix/pull/4675)
* Fix https://github.com/mozilla-mobile/fenix/issues/4436: hide onboarding before navigating to settings

* No issue: Rename emitAccountChanges to emitModeChanges
5 years ago
Sebastian Kaspari 4cba063e4e [fenix] Issue https://github.com/mozilla-mobile/fenix/issues/4431: Integrate feature-media component (Nightly and debug builds only). (https://github.com/mozilla-mobile/fenix/pull/4683) 5 years ago
Sebastian Kaspari d7f108f7cb [fenix] Use Mozilla Android Components 8.0.0. (https://github.com/mozilla-mobile/fenix/pull/4706)
This should build and is needed right away, but taskcluster scopes are messed up right now.
5 years ago
Mihai Tabara 92bc173506 [fenix] Bug 1573512 - rename codecov secret to something more generic for master and PR to reuse (https://github.com/mozilla-mobile/fenix/pull/4705)
Force merging since we're blocked on this change and TaskCluster is stuck after 4 hours.
5 years ago
Emily Kager 3b49b1bde6 [fenix] Create ---webcontent-issue-report.md 5 years ago
Colin Lee de2b2a74c9 [fenix] For https://github.com/mozilla-mobile/fenix/issues/4652: HomeFragment Crash "Can not.. after onSaveInstanceState" 5 years ago
Jorge De Los Santos 3cfa2aff96 [fenix] For https://github.com/mozilla-mobile/fenix/issues/3424 - Make talkback ignore ImageButton in Collection Sele… (https://github.com/mozilla-mobile/fenix/pull/3792)
For https://github.com/mozilla-mobile/fenix/issues/3424 - Make talkback ignore ImageButton in Collection Selection by removing contentDescription and setting importantForAccessibility=no
5 years ago
Grisha Kruglov caeb3477b9 [fenix] Closes https://github.com/mozilla-mobile/fenix/issues/4671: Fix a potential NPE in BookmarkFragment 5 years ago
Grisha Kruglov cd52df3314 [fenix] No issue: add some BookmarkFragmentInteractor tests 5 years ago
Grisha Kruglov 88db14a22f [fenix] No issue: reduce code duplication in BookmarkFragmentInteractor 5 years ago
Christian Sadilek 9b956a3c42 [fenix] For https://github.com/mozilla-mobile/fenix/issues/4125: Suppress coroutine warning to fix release build 5 years ago
Sawyer Blatz 20b0c30640 [fenix] For https://github.com/mozilla-mobile/fenix/issues/4123: Adds telemetry for quick action open in app (https://github.com/mozilla-mobile/fenix/pull/4629) 5 years ago
Yeon Taek Jeong ae90650052 [fenix] ktlint fix 5 years ago
Yeon Taek Jeong b050218cd6 [fenix] Finish adding tests 5 years ago
Yeon Taek Jeong 6517ffed64 [fenix] Fix, add some tests 5 years ago
Yeon Taek Jeong b190e9b80d [fenix] Fix rest of issues 5 years ago
Yeon Taek Jeong b3ef78f3cc [fenix] Fix most issues 5 years ago
Yeon Taek Jeong 8391e933be [fenix] For https://github.com/mozilla-mobile/fenix/issues/4125: Migrate Sign in to Sync to Libstate 5 years ago
Axel Hecht 059ee1671d [fenix] Import strings from android-l10n (https://github.com/mozilla-mobile/fenix/pull/4643)
State: mozilla-l10n/android-l10n@ab580f757c
5 years ago
Colin Lee 9124321227 [fenix] For https://github.com/mozilla-mobile/fenix/issues/4652: Crash "Can not perform this action after onSaveInstanceState" (https://github.com/mozilla-mobile/fenix/pull/4654) 5 years ago
Jonathan Almeida d544526692 [fenix] No issue: Disable failing ActivationPingTest 5 years ago
Tiger Oakes 025fc336b1 [fenix] Consodilate private browsing code 5 years ago
marianrai 4e0bbf3a14 [fenix] Changed the group_symbol to 'Rap' and added a new condition for ARM_RAPTOR_URL_PARAMS usage. 5 years ago
Jonathan Almeida d3ff33d2d9 [fenix] For https://github.com/mozilla-mobile/fenix/issues/4066: Create InflationAwareFeature for lazy inflation 5 years ago